`
lovnet
  • 浏览: 6881384 次
  • 性别: Icon_minigender_1
  • 来自: 武汉
文章分类
社区版块
存档分类
最新评论

VB调用webbrowser技巧集2

阅读更多

向Webbrowser中写入HTML内容的几种方法

首先在Form_Load中加入

WebBrowser1.Navigate "about:blank"

确保Webbrowser1可用

方法1:

Dim s As String
Dim stream As IStream

s = ""
s = s + ""
s = s + ""
s = s + "

hello world

"
s = s + ""
s = s + "
WebBrowser1.Document.Write s

方法2:

Dim o

Set o = WebBrowser1.Document.selection.createrange
Debug.Print o
If (Not o Is Nothing) Then
o.pasteHTML "哈哈"
Set o = Nothing
End If

方法3:

'插入文本框
Dim o

Set o = WebBrowser1.Document.selection.createrange

o.execCommand "InsertTextArea", False, "xxx"

其中方法3是采用了调用execCommand并且传递控制命令的方法,通过这种方法还可以插入图片等页面元素,详情可以参考MSDN的execCommand命令。

分享到:
评论

相关推荐

    VB调用webbrowser技巧集

    Webbrowser控件史上最强技巧全集 VB调用webbrowser技巧集

    VB控件WEBBROWSER基本及进阶技巧合集.doc

    VB控件WebBrowser是Visual Basic开发环境中用于在应用程序内嵌入网页...以上就是VB控件WebBrowser的一些基本和进阶使用技巧,掌握这些技巧可以帮助开发者更灵活地在应用程序中集成网页浏览功能,实现丰富的交互体验。

    vb-webbrowser获取网页文本

    ### vb-webbrowser获取网页文本 #### 知识点概述 在本篇文章中,我们将深入探讨如何使用Visual Basic(简称VB)中的WebBrowser控件来获取网页的文本内容,而不是简单的HTML源码。此方法适用于那些希望从网页中提取...

    VB中WEBBROWSER技巧大全(DOC文档)

    ### VB中WEBBROWSER技巧大全知识点详解 #### 一、WebBrowser的方法、属性与事件 WebBrowser 控件是Visual Basic中用于浏览和交互HTML文档的强大工具。它支持一系列的方法、属性和事件,允许开发者实现复杂的网页...

    VB基于WebBrowser组件打开Word文件.rar

    在这个特定的例子中,开发者利用WebBrowser组件来加载和展示Word文档的内容,而无需直接调用Microsoft Word应用程序。 首先,我们需要理解WebBrowser组件的基本用法。在VB中,添加WebBrowser组件到窗体(Form)是...

    VB_检测WebBrowser网页_刷新_加载_变更_关闭

    在VB(Visual Basic)编程中,`WebBrowser`控件是一个强大的工具,允许开发者在应用程序中嵌入浏览器功能。这个控件可以加载网页、执行网页交互,并且对网页的加载状态进行监控。在这个主题中,我们将深入探讨如何...

    VB代码使用WebBrowser控件作为容器打开Word文档

    在VB中,我们可以通过创建一个`Word.Application`对象并调用其方法来控制Word。例如,我们可以使用`Documents.Open`方法来打开一个文档,并设置`Visible`属性为`True`使其可见: ```vb Dim objWord As Object Dim ...

    VB调用百度地图示例

    4. **VB调用JavaScript**: 在VB中,我们可以通过WebBrowser控件的`Document`属性访问HTML文档,然后执行JavaScript代码。例如,要调用上面的初始化地图的代码,可以这样做: ```vb WebBrowser1.Document....

    vb6.0调用webservice详解

    在VB6.0中调用Web Service,可以将传统的桌面应用与网络服务无缝集成,实现更丰富的功能。 首先,调用Web Service的基本步骤包括以下几点: 1. **获取WSDL文件**:Web Service通常通过一个名为WSDL(Web Services ...

    VB6嵌入谷歌浏览器

    在VB6(Visual Basic 6)中嵌入谷歌浏览器,主要涉及到的是ActiveX技术的应用,以及与WebBrowser控件的交互。以下将详细介绍这个过程,包括相关知识点和步骤。 首先,VB6是一个经典的Windows应用程序开发环境,它...

    VB如何调用WebService

    在探讨“VB如何调用WebService”的主题时,我们首先需要理解几个关键概念:Visual Basic(简称VB),WebService,以及SOAP协议。Visual Basic是一种由微软开发的面向对象的编程语言,广泛应用于Windows平台上的应用...

    调用浏览器程序(VB6.0源代码)

    这个项目就是关于如何使用Visual Basic 6.0(VB6.0)源代码来调用浏览器并加载URL的功能。下面我们将深入探讨这个知识点。 首先,VB6.0中的"Shell"函数是调用外部程序的关键。`Shell`函数允许我们启动一个操作系统...

    VB.zip_WebBrowser vb_vb WebBrowser_vb 浏览器_webbrowser

    2. **导航功能**:`WebBrowser`控件的主要功能之一就是网页导航。通过调用`WebBrowser.Navigate`方法,可以指定URL进行加载,如`wb.Navigate("http://www.example.com")`。此外,还可以利用`Navigating`事件在页面...

    VB调用BaiduMap示例

    这个“VB调用BaiduMap示例”就是一个典型的例子,它展示了如何在VB应用程序中嵌入并操作百度地图。下面我们将详细探讨这个示例中的关键知识点。 首先,我们要理解VB中的WebBrowser控件。这是一个内置的组件,允许VB...

    C# VB NET Webbrowser 浏览器 编程

    4. **JavaScript交互**:WebBrowser控件支持执行JavaScript代码,并通过`ObjectForScripting`属性设置一个对象,使得JavaScript可以调用.NET对象的方法,实现C#或VB.NET与JavaScript之间的双向通信。 5. **打印支持*...

    利用vb的WebBrowser控件开发的网页浏览器

    此外,设置浏览器的界面语言是一个更复杂的功能,可能需要访问WebBrowser控件的`Object`属性,这是一个指向IE内核的接口,可以调用其更底层的方法。通过这个接口,开发者可以尝试修改浏览器的语言设置,但这可能受到...

Global site tag (gtag.js) - Google Analytics